Reliance Industries (RIL) has been distilling its investment strategy to meet new goals. The share of the new energy vertical - its key focus area - accounts for more than a fourth (26 per cent) of the total war chest of $6.4 billion, ploughed into acquisitions and picking up stake from 2018 to date, reveals the latest Morgan Stanley data. Nearly half the incremental investments made on deals by RIL between August 2020 and September this year ($3.3 billion) has been spent on new energy - acquiring global companies with technology and expertise.

Online video platform YouTube's ecosystem has contributed over Rs 10,000 crore to India's GDP and supported more than 7.5 lakh full-time equivalent jobs in the country, according to a report. In India, over 4,500 channels had over 10 lakh subscribers and the number of YouTube channels in India making Rs 1 lakh or more in their annual revenue increased by over 60 per cent year-over-year in 2021, the YouTube Impact Report based on analysis by Oxford Economics said. "YouTube's creative ecosystem contributed over Rs 10,000 crore and supported more than 7,50,000 full-time equivalent jobs in the Indian economy in 2021. "That economic impact shows up in four ways, through direct, indirect, induced, and catalytic impacts," the report said.
